ESR6 – Emmanouil Archontakis (TUE)

Background: Physics, Photonics, Nanoelectronics

Profile: Emmanouil Archontakis obtained his Bachelor’s and Master’s degree in Physics from the University of Crete, Greece. He carried out his master thesis in Photonics & Nanoelectronics at the same university, focusing on non-linear optical microscopy in the Institute of Electronic Structure and Laser (IESL-FORTH). Emmanouil is currently working as a PhD Marie Curie Fellow at professor Lorenzo Albertazzi’s Nanoscopy for Nanomedicine group, in the Institute of Complex Molecular Systems, at TU/e

ETN Topic: Single molecule imaging of prodyes activation
